Cobwebs Webinar - EXIF Data and How It Can Benefit Open-Source Investigations
Description:
Please join us on Wednesday February 24th at 1pm EST to discuss EXIF data – what it is, where we can find it and how extracting information from these files can aide in your investigations. Social media platforms, web services, and even messaging apps often remove GPS and other forms of vital information from media they process. However, media uploaded to online forums, the dark web and blog pictures often still contain EXIF data. During this session we will cover methods to uncover this information, learn more about photos and videos posted online, all in an open-source format.
